This appears to be a mythtv issue and you'd be better to post to their mailing list. However I'll help with what I can:

What makes you think you're still running 0.25? What does
Code:
mythbackend --version
dpkg -l mythtv*
tell you?

And I wouldn't upgrade to 0.27 if you haven't already. It hasn't been released - you would be running experimental code. Better to go with 0.26.
